check with your doctor appendix 1 if you KNOW for sure that everythimg is fine and you dont need to see the doctor en thats fine (within 2 days)

health delcaration form sign and upload (within 2 days)

appendix 2: you fill that yourself and you need to be honest about it (within 2 days)

appendix 3: all your vaccinations that you will need done before you travel the world even if you had them when you was a child you will still need a booster. if you dont get them done in your home country, you will have to take them in dubai and the charge will be taken off your monthly wages. (within 10 days) needs to be signed by your doctor

appendix 4: dental, you need an xray and you will need your dentist to fill the form out for you and signed.(within 10 days)
